What should I do? We have just had flooding in our home!
DO THIS
-
Identify the source of the incoming water and if possible stop it or call a professional to stop the water.
-
Turn off all electrical appliances in and around the area affected by the water to reduce electrical hazards
-
Remove or elevate furniture off wet areas to prevent permanent stains or rust marks from occurring
-
Empty out closed floors, including shoes and cardboard boxes, which could cause staining
NEVER DO THIS
- Never turn on ceiling fixtures if the ceiling is wet, and stay away from sagging ceilings
- Never rip up the carpet and padding. This can cause permanent damage to the materials.
- Never leave books, newspapers or other paper materials on wet carpets and floors.
- Never attempt to dry carpeting with an electric heater. It will only dry the surface and not the padding underneath.
- NEVER turn up the heat above 68 degrees! This will cause mildew to become active!
